The Borno State Police Command has confirmed the tragic death of Police Inspector Abdulkadir Garba, popularly known as “Buratai,” after he was struck by lightning while on duty in Maiduguri, the Borno State capital.
The incident occurred on Wednesday, May 7, 2026, at about 2:19 p.m., as heavy rain and strong winds gathered around the command headquarters.
According to the Police Public Relations Officer, ASP Nahum Daso, Inspector Garba was coordinating vehicle parking opposite the Borno State Police Command headquarters alongside his senior colleague, ASP Wazani Adamu, when the unexpected tragedy happened.
Daso explained that both officers attempted to seek shelter moments before the rain began but were struck by lightning before they could reach safety.
“Rain often comes with its own blessings, but this one arrived with a heartbreaking streak of tragedy,” the police spokesperson said in a tribute released on Friday.
He added that while ASP Wazani Adamu survived the incident “in what may be described as a miracle,” Inspector Garba suffered severe impact from the lightning strike and later died from partial burns sustained on his body.
Describing the late officer as dedicated and hardworking, Daso said Garba was widely respected for his commitment to duty and service to humanity.
“He lost his life, not to violence or conflict, but to the force of the storm,” Daso stated.
The command said the sudden death of the officer has left colleagues, friends, and residents in shock and mourning, remembering him as a familiar and devoted officer who served tirelessly under harsh weather conditions to maintain order.
